Getting Started

To start using this API, you only have to do the typical Rails things:

  • Install Ruby version 2.2.2 (using RVM or RBenv or whatever).

  • Clone the repo and do the bundle install thing:

user@computer:~$ git clone git@github.com:dreamingechoes/grape_example_app.git
user@computer:~$ cd grape_example_app
user@computer:/grape_example_app$ bundle install
user@computer:/grape_example_app$ rake db:setup
  • When all this finish, you're ready to launch the app!
user@computer:/grape_example_app$ rails s

NOTE: the seed.rb file has an ApiKey example token for testing the API, which is 18dfef7acf97765b54abecdf86a25bba, but on ApiKey.create() method it assigns other random access_token. If you want to use the example token for testing purpose, update via console the attribute access_token of the ApiKey to 18dfef7acf97765b54abecdf86a25bba, like this:

user@computer:/grape_example_app$ rails console
Loading development environment (Rails 4.2.4)
>> a = ApiKey.first
  ApiKey Load (0.3ms)  SELECT  `api_keys`.* FROM `api_keys`  ORDER BY `api_keys`.`id` ASC LIMIT 1
=> #<ApiKey id: 2, access_token: "k93eeqa34f9774rko4abecdf86a2nckm", expires_at: "2043-03-12 21:03:46", user_id: 3, active: nil, created_at: "2015-10-26 21:03:46", updated_at: "2015-10-26 21:05:03">
>> a.update_attribute(:access_token, "18dfef7acf97765b54abecdf86a25bba")
   (1.8ms)  BEGIN
   (0.1ms)  COMMIT
=> true
